Ingham County, MI Sees 26.1% of Properties Corporate-Owned in July 2026

Ingham County, Michigan, reveals a significant concentration of investor presence, with 26.1% of its properties held by corporate entities. This figure places the county above both state and national averages for corporate ownership, signaling a distinct market dynamic for real estate investors and market watchers.

County Ownership Overview

According to BatchData's Property Ownership by Owner Type Report for July 2026, Ingham County, MI, which includes the state capital Lansing, has 120,303 properties analyzed. The data indicates that individually-owned properties make up the largest segment at 65.8%, reflecting traditional homeownership patterns. However, corporate-owned properties represent a substantial 26.1% of the market. Trust-owned properties account for the remaining 8.1%, indicating a notable portion of assets managed through trusts for estate planning or investment purposes. This ownership structure offers a clear picture of who holds the deeds in Ingham County, differentiating between private individuals, corporate entities, and trusts.

Ingham County's corporate ownership share of 26.1% stands out when compared to broader market trends. The state of Michigan has a corporate ownership share of 20.4%, while the national total for corporate-owned properties is 21.6%. Ingham County thus demonstrates a higher concentration of corporate investment than both its state and the nation as a whole. This suggests an elevated interest from institutional and other corporate investors in the Ingham County market, positioning it as an area with a more pronounced investor footprint compared to many other regions. The county ranks #16 among Michigan's 83 counties, underscoring its relative importance and activity within the state's real estate landscape.

Local Market Context and Investor Implications

A deeper dive into the ownership structure within Ingham County reveals further insights into investor activity and market composition. Among the 120,303 properties analyzed, 66,580 properties, or 55.3%, are held by single property owners. This category often encompasses traditional homeowners and smaller mom-and-pop landlords. Crucially, multi-property owners account for 49,778 properties, representing 41.4% of the total. This high percentage of multi-property ownership is a strong indicator of significant real estate investing activity, suggesting that a considerable portion of properties are held for rental income, portfolio diversification, or other investment strategies rather than primary residency. A smaller segment of 3,945 properties, or 3.3%, are categorized as having no owner, which may include properties in transition or with unresolved ownership records.
